What are the primary responsibilities and challenges faced by an Assistant Core Lab in a hospital setting?

As an Assistant Core Lab in a hospital, your main responsibilities include preparing specimens, operating and maintaining laboratory equipment, and ensuring timely delivery of accurate test results. You'll often work closely with medical technologists, pathologists, and other healthcare professionals to support diagnostic processes. Common challenges include managing high sample volumes during peak hours, adhering to strict protocols for quality and safety, and prioritizing tasks in a fast-paced environment. This role offers valuable experience in clinical laboratory operations and can serve as a stepping stone for advancement into more specialized laboratory positions.

What are Assistant Core Lab professionals?

Assistant Core Lab professionals are support staff who work in the core laboratory section of medical or clinical labs. They assist with the preparation, processing, and analysis of biological specimens such as blood, urine, and tissue samples. Their responsibilities often include specimen sorting, labeling, data entry, and ensuring proper operation and maintenance of lab equipment. By supporting laboratory technologists and scientists, Assistant Core Lab professionals help ensure accurate and timely test results, which are crucial for patient care and diagnosis.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Assistant Core Lab,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Core Lab, you need a basic understanding of laboratory procedures, attention to detail,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ent with some lab experience preferred. Familiarity with laboratory information systems (LIS), automated analyzers, and proper specimen handling protocols is essential. Strong organizational skills, reliability, and effective communication help ensure smooth workflow and collaboration within the lab team. These skills and qualities are crucial for maintaining accuracy, efficiency, and compliance with safety standards in a clinical laboratory environment.

JOB SUMMARY

Responsible for assisting with specified technical procedures in one or more sections of the Clinical Laboratory. Performs a variety of tasks requiring skills in phlebotomy and general office to include customer service, clerical and computer/data entry.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
  • Retrieves specimens from pneumatic tube system and initiates processing. Prepares samples for analysis by manual or automated methods in accordance with instructions in the section procedure manual and defined standards of performance. Distributes to work areas and loads specimens on designated instruments where applicable. Performs department specific duties to assist tech (i.e. blood bank, micro).
  • Prepares specimens to be sent out for reference testing including: completing of requisition, packaging, storage and notification to courier for pickup.
  • Performs and documents instrument function verification, preventative maintenance and troubleshooting on equipment to ensure proper operation according to section guidelines.
  • Answers telephone and follows through with requests. Maintains inventory and stock supplies. Reviews all laboratory/hospital system policies, procedures and communications. Assists in training new staff and students.
  • Performs phlebotomy as assigned.
  • Other duties as assigned.

HonorHealth is a non-profit, local community healthcare system serving an area of 1.6 million people in the greater Phoenix area. The network encompasses six acute-care hospitals, an extensive medical group, outpatient surgery centers, a cancer care network, clinical research, medical education, a foundation, and community services with approximately 13,100 team members, 3,500 affiliated providers and nearly 700 volunteers. HonorHealth was formed by a merger between Scottsdale Healthcare and John C. Lincoln Health Network. HonorHealth's mission is to improve the health and well-being of those we serve.
